I am thinking of using a 2m length of 5mm rod to make a marine danbuoy which I will use as a pick up buoy on a swinging mooring for my 30ft boat. This rod will pass through a float and have a weight attached to the base to keep it upright. Do you think that carbon fibre would be a suitable product for this purpose please and, if so, would a 5mm rod be appropriate or should it be a larger diameter? Many thanks, Colin
